Output 77a5e1e2dcbbc1ddd1b55ca32ebbc47c0e6168d2dffda66c1288f1fc1a5cfb76:21

value
2584812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66e22a1d9da92976b7982377ca38fb8ab1e2b89 OP_EQUAL
address
3MEpTvqUxpqYaLeZaPKxE11jdbg6cRZPjJ
transaction
77a5e1e2dcbbc1ddd1b55ca32ebbc47c0e6168d2dffda66c1288f1fc1a5cfb76
spent
true